Quinoa protein hydrolysate (QpH) serves as both a nitrogen source and a functional ingredient for L. plantarum. Bacteria grown in QpH achieved high biomass production and demonstrated significantly enhanced cell membrane integrity, positioning QpH as a key component for robust, plant‐based probiotics.

Exploration of Collagen as Binder for Aqueous Zinc Batteries and Symmetric Carbon Supercapacitors
Aqueous dispersions of native collagen were successfully explored as “green” binders in oxide cathodes for zinc batteries and in carbon electrodes for aqueous double‐layer supercapacitors.
